Mike Schloesser takes third Vegas Shoot title
The Netherlands' Mike Schloesser won the Championship Compound Open division at the Vegas Shoot for the 3rd time after victories in 2014 and 2017. Many times a finalist, he outlasted a record field of 32 archers on the stage. "I'm super emotional. I'm super excited," said the Dutchman. Ella Gibson wins historic women's Vegas championship
Great Britain's Ella Gibson is the new Vegas champion, after a historic five-way shootoff in the Championship Compound Female division. After the first end of inner-10 scoring, Miller was eliminated and Morgan Rives took third spot. Gibson and Alexis Ruiz shot down for the championship. History made: Five women shoot 900 and make 2026 Vegas Shoot final
For the first time in Vegas Shoot history, the Championship Compound Female competition will be a five-way shootdown. Ella Gibson , Julia 'Morgan' Rives , Tanja Gellenthien , Alexis Ruiz , and Taylor Miller shot clean through Sunday morning's final scoring round for 900. All previous shootdowns in the category have been head-to-heads, and Ruiz, Miller and Rives become only the 10th, 11th and 12th women in the entire 60 year history of the Vegas Shoot to shoot 900s. History made as ELEVEN women shoot clean on 2nd day of Vegas Shoot 2026
Eleven women stayed clean in the Championship Compound Female division through the second day of the 2026 Vegas Shoot – the most that have ever made the 600 mark. Olivia Dean , Muskan Kirar , Ella Gibson , Julia 'Morgan' Rives , Tanja Gellenthien , Paige Pearce , Jordan Borgmeyer , Alexis Ruiz , Taylor Miller , Gracen Fletcher and Adriana Castillo all shot 300 on Saturday, with Dean and Kirar sitting on top of the pile with 600 51x each.
